Administrative Assistant
100% On Site
Ridgecrest, CA
The Administrative Assistant is responsible for providing administrative assistance to management. Duties may include calendar and inbox management for department or managers, ordering supplies, coordinating travel arrangements and expense report submission. Gathers, collects, records, tracks and verifies information from multiple sources. Work performed at a higher level may include evaluating information gathered and developing recommendations. May perform as a generalist in a combination of administrative tasks for a function, line or specific program.
Education Requirements : Minimum High School Diploma or equivalent
